Essential Resources in the World of Audio And Video Editor

Audio And Video Editor utilizes a rich array of resources:

  • Industry-Leading Applications: Applications such as Final Cut Pro provide robust functionalities.
  • Budget-Friendly and Open-Source Options: Programs such as Shotcut offer solid performance for basic projects.
  • Remote Editing and Online Tools: Platforms like Adobe Spark allow editing from anywhere.
  • High-Performance Hardware and Peripheral Devices: Utilize calibrated monitors, graphic tablets, and professional audio systems to support smooth operations in Audio And Video Editor.
